German Township is one of 14 townships of Auglaize County in the U.S. state of Ohio. According to the census in 2000 3831 inhabitants were registered here.

Geography

German Township is located in the southwest of the Auglaize counties in northwest Ohio and bordered clockwise to the townships: Saint Marys Township, Van Buren Township, Shelby County, McLean Township ( Shelby County), Jackson Township, Marion Township, Mercer County and Franklin Township ( Mercer County).

History

The German Township is one of five townships of the same name in Ohio. Formerly it was formed as part of Mercer County, and included the area of Jackson Township, to its elimination in 1858.
